§ 1207. Contents and time of answer. For the purpose of reckoning the\ntime within which a respondent must appear or answer, service by\npublication under this article is complete on the twenty-eighth day\nafter the date of first publication. Any respondent, or any person\nmaking claim to any of the property or funds described in the petition,\nshall have sixty days after completion of service within which to\nappear, and the time for all further proceedings shall be as prescribed\nfor proceedings in the supreme court. The answer shall be verified,\nshall set forth the true name, residence and business address, if any,\nof the claiming respondent, and shall set forth in full detail the basis\nof the claim and the respondent's claim of title thereto.\n
